From c3bd443e5dc5111383a6539613134f85da648981 Mon Sep 17 00:00:00 2001 From: Michael Hiiva Date: Wed, 2 Sep 2020 21:25:56 -0700 Subject: [PATCH] Added unicode check for game dates. --- agagd/agagd_core/views/core.py |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/agagd/agagd_core/views/core.py b/agagd/agagd_core/views/core.py index 2993c828..cc1467f0 100644 --- a/agagd/agagd_core/views/core.py +++ b/agagd/agagd_core/views/core.py @@ -132,7 +132,15 @@ def member_detail(request, member_id): t_dat['tournament'] = game.tournament_code t_dat['won'] = t_dat.get('won', 0) t_dat['lost'] = t_dat.get('lost', 0) - t_dat['date'] = t_dat.get('date', game.game_date) + + # Set default game_date to None + game_date = None + + # Check for 0000-00-00 dates + if game.game_date != u'0000-00-00': + game_date = game.game_date + + t_dat['date'] = t_dat.get('date', game_date) op = game.player_other_than(player) opp_dat = opponent_data.get(op, {})